曲线拟合用于4台血细胞分析仪之间的非线性比对研究

Nonlinear comparison study on 4 hemotology analyzers using curve estimation program

【摘要】 目的利用非线性过程对不同血细胞分析仪之间的结果进行比对研究。方法每天收集5份高、中、低不同浓度水平的病人血液样本,每份样本分别使用Bayer120、CD3500、BC5500和BC3000血细胞分析仪进行测定,利用SPSS曲线拟合(Curve Estimation)程序的11种回归模型(包括线性模型)对不同仪器WBC,RBC和HGB项目的测定结果进行拟合。结果所选出的最佳模型的决定系数值均大于0.981(相关系数大于0.990),这使血细胞分析仪之间的方法比对和偏差估计更为准确可靠,且可比对范围更广。结论非线性比对适用于临床检验的方法比对和偏差估计。

【Abstract】 Objective To compare the measured results from 4 hemotology analyzers using nonlinear procedure. Methods Daily 5 blood samples with high, normal and low measured values from patients were collected and analyzed respectively using 4 hemotology analyzers, Bayer120, CD3500, BC5500 and BC3000. The measured results of WBC, RBC, HGB and PLT from CD3500, BC5500 and BC3000 were respectively related to Bayer120 through 11 regression models (including linear model) from SPSS curve estimation program. Results The coefficient of determination (R2) of all best regression models found out was more than 0.981, and then method comparison and bias estimation between different hemotology analyzers could be made with more exact bias estimation and wider comparative range than only using linear model. Conclusion Nonlinear comparison is suitable for method comparison and bias estimation for clinic laboratory.
